What is surprising and ironic about Peter apologizing to Ender? Ender sees Peter’s silhouette and fears Peter will kill him. Instead, Peter apologizes and tells Ender he loves him.

What happened to Ender's monitor in Ender's game?
Suddenly, their brother Peter, the oldest child, walks in. Peter is a charismatic 10-year-old boy, but from Ender’s perspective he’s a brutal bully. Peter immediately notices that Ender’s monitor has been removed. He mutters that Ender “almost made it,” and adds that he lost his monitor at the age of 5, while Valentine lost hers at 3.
Why does Peter Cry in Ender's game?
We sense that Peter, in spite of his capacity for evil, also wants to be loved, and can experience regret for his actions. This is precisely what makes Ender cry: Ender recognizes that he really is like Peter, not only in the sense that he’s capable of great harm, but also because he wants to be good.

How does Peter feel about Ender?
His brother Peter is angered by the fact that Ender had his monitor for longer than he did. Peter decides that he and Ender should play buggers and astronauts, a common children's game. However, Peter actually hurts Ender during the game, as he has in the past, treating his brother like a hated enemy.

What happens to Peter in Ender's game?
Peter eventually gains power over the entire earth and becomes the Hegemon, the leader of the world.

Is Ender more like Peter or Valentine?
Ender is more similar in personality to Valentine than Peter because he is compassionate, selfless, and remorseful, while Peter is not. One trait that Ender and Valentine share are their overwhelming sense of compassion, in other words, their sympathy and concern for the suffering and misfortune of others.

Why is Peter angry about Ender's situation with the monitor?
Why is Peter angry about Peter's situation with the monitor? Peter is jealous because Ender has has his monitor over a year longer than Peter indicating that Ender is more special. What was Peter's threat to Valentine and Ender? That he will kill them, making it look like an accident.
Is Peter evil in Ender's game?
Peter. Ender's older brother Peter is a cruel and evil child, gifted in manipulation. He has the same ruthlessness that his siblings contain but without any of their compassion.

How does Ender stop Bernard's attempt to be ruler of the room and why is he happy about it?
How does Ender stop Bernard's attempt to be "ruler of the room," and why is he happy about it? Ender uses his intelligence instead of violence and breaks the security system used on the desks. He sends messages to all the desks making fun of Bernard and signs them "God."
Why does Ender refer to himself as Speaker for the Dead?
Andrew Wiggin (Ender) is still alive, due to the relativistic time effects of space travel. He serves as a “Speaker for the Dead,” travelling around the universe to speak on the significance of those who have recently died.
What mission does Ender go on at the end of the book?
What mission does Ender undertake at the end of the novel? He leaves the colony to search for a world for the buggers to re-establish a civilization. He and Valentine go off in search of new adventures because the colony has become boring for them.

What does Peter say to Ender and Valentine?
The mood suddenly changes when Peter falls to his bed laughing and tries to convince Ender and Valentine that his behavior and words were only a joke. Peter says, "I can make you guys believe anything. I can make you dance around like puppets."
What does the speaker say about Ender?
The speaker knows Ender is capable. He reveals taking Ender into the academy and surrounding him with enemies will help save the world, and this outweighs the negative effects the experience will have on Ender.
Why does Valentine want to protect Ender?
Valentine wants to protect Ender from Peter. Since Ender is now without a monitor, Valentine hopes Peter will see Ender as an equal, one without a monitor. Valentine threatens to call their father when Peter begins physically hurting Ender during the game. Valentine also threatens to ruin Peter's chances of ever working in government by writing a letter about his cruel treatment of Ender and keeping it in a secret place.
Why does Peter use the monitor?
Peter uses the monitor to make Ender feel obligated. Peter says, "Oh, is the monitor boy too busy to help his brother?" Ender hopes losing his monitor will change the jealousy and hatred Peter feels for him, but he knows Peter will never leave him alone. Ender and Peter will merely be brothers living in the same home.
How many times does Ender kick Stilson?
Ender kicks Stilson 3 times as he lies helpless and bleeding. This is a warning to the gang that any retaliation on behalf of Stilson will lead to a worse beating than the merciless one Stilson received. Ender also states this as a warning.
Why is Ender's father embarrassed?
Ender's father is disappointed and embarrassed because he thinks Ender will not be chosen for the academy. His father wonders how he will explain Ender's existence as a Third now that he cannot say his third son is being considered for the academy. Ender's father voices this opinion repeatedly in Ender's presence making Ender feel like an inconvenience.
Why doesn't Ender's teacher bother Ender?
Ender's teacher never bothers Ender when he is not paying attention in class because he always knows the answer anyway. Valentine taught Ender arithmetic when he was three. Ender figures out how to send messages from desk to desk and make them march.
What does Ender's mother say to Ender?
Ender’s mother, whom he simply calls Mother, tells Ender that she’s sorry about his pain. Father points out that it was an honor that the government allowed their family to have three children—proof of their children’s vast intelligence.
What do Ender and Peter do in Astronauts and Buggers?
Peter and Ender begin playing Astronauts and Buggers. Ender imagines the Buggers, living on another planet, playing their own version of the game in which the Buggers always win. Peter punches Ender and pushes him to the floor. He jeers that he could kill Ender if he wanted—he could pretend that he didn’t know he was killing his brother, and their parents would believe him. Valentine, who’s been watching the game, says that she’d tell the truth. Peter threatens to kill her, too. Valentine calmly says that Peter could never “get elected” if his two siblings died under mysterious circumstances. She adds that she and Ender are just as clever as Peter, and cleverer in some ways. Peter lets Ender up. He seems angry for a split second, but then begins laughing hysterically at Valentine and Ender, insisting that he was only joking.
